Hi there,
Quick question about a recent breakdown I had with my Santa fe commercial. Garage told me an idler bearing had collapsed causing timing belt to go. Jeep only has 49,000 miles on it but is 3years 5months old. Even though Im just passed the 3year warrantee, do I have any comeback against the faulty bearing. Seem way to soon for this to fail...?

Thanks,

Dave.

Answer
While it's true that the life expectancy of most pulley bearings is much greater than 3.5 years and 49,000 miles, Hyundai is under no obligation to repair anything that fails outside the warranty period.  The best you'll ever be able to do is ask Hyundai if they'll offer any assistance on repair.  If you're not at a Hyundai repair facility, the chances of receiving assistance are close to zero.
